Stoughton 2015–2017 Service Brakes, Air recall
Recalled May 23, 2016 · NHTSA recall 16V338000 · Stoughton
Hazard
If the parking brake chamber fails while the trailer is parked, the trailer may roll away, increasing the risk of crash or injury.
Remedy
Stoughton will contact owners and provide a remedy kit, complete with instructions, to repair any affected SR-5 trailer relay valves, free of charge. The recall began on July 26, 2016. Owners may contact Stoughton customer service at 1-608-873-2500.
Units
2,657 units
Description
Stoughton Trailers, LLC (Stoughton) is recalling certain model year 2015-2017 trailers manufactured March 13, 2014, to April 28, 2016, equipped with certain Bendix SR5 spring brake valves. These valves may have been improperly machined which may cause the parking brake chamber to fail while the trailer is parked.
